public class BeaconRegionRanger extends java.lang.Object implements RegionRanger<BeaconRegion,Beacon>
| Constructor and Description |
|---|
BeaconRegionRanger(AnalyticsManager analyticsManager) |
| Modifier and Type | Method and Description |
|---|---|
void |
add(BeaconRegion region) |
void |
clear() |
boolean |
isActive() |
void |
processNewScanCycle(java.util.List<Beacon> singleScan,
BeaconServiceMessenger messenger) |
boolean |
removeByRegionId(java.lang.String regionId) |
public void add(BeaconRegion region)
add in interface RegionRanger<BeaconRegion,Beacon>public boolean removeByRegionId(java.lang.String regionId)
removeByRegionId in interface RegionRanger<BeaconRegion,Beacon>public void processNewScanCycle(java.util.List<Beacon> singleScan, BeaconServiceMessenger messenger)
processNewScanCycle in interface RegionRanger<BeaconRegion,Beacon>public boolean isActive()
isActive in interface RegionRanger<BeaconRegion,Beacon>public void clear()
clear in interface RegionRanger<BeaconRegion,Beacon>